Indianapolis 500: Ganassi's Sage Karam leads Monday practice

Sage Karam led a Ganassi one-two-three to set the pace on a rain-interrupted second day of practice for this year's Indianapolis 500

Karam secured the top spot with an average speed of 225.802mph, putting himself just ahead of team-mates Scott Dixon and Tony Kanaan.

"It's not about how fast you are today, it's about how fast you are on Sunday in two weeks," said Karam, who finished ninth on his debut at Indy last year.

"It definitely feels good, though.

"It's the first time I've ever been P1 at the Speedway, so it's a good feeling.

"We have a lot of work to do. The car's not anywhere near where we want it to be for race day or qualifying.

"We are picking this new aero kit apart and we're figuring it out every time we go out."

Strong gusts of wind prompted left several teams content to spend the day watching from the sidelines - Penske's Juan Pablo Montoya, Will Power and Helio Castroneves only completed five laps between them, although Simon Pagenaud did 31.

But there was still enough time for a handful of drivers to tick off their refresher and Rookie Orientation Programmes, including newcomer Stefano Coletti.

"I have been waiting for three months to get on the Indianapolis Motor Speedway oval," said the Monegasque.

"I didn't get to do the first ROP because I was stuck in Europe because of my visa.

"I finally got to go out on track, and I am very happy. It's very fast."

Elsewhere, Trey Harkins, the fueler on James Jakes' Schmidt car, suffered a left thumb contusion when his was hit by debris when the starter broke.

He was treated and released from the IU Health Emergency Medical Centre.

MONDAY SPEEDS AND TIMES:

Pos Driver Team Car Speed Time Laps
1 Sage Karam Chip Ganassi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 225.802 39.8579s 41
2 Scott Dixon Chip Ganassi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 225.293 39.9480s 27
3 Tony Kanaan Chip Ganassi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 225.217 39.9615s 26
4 Marco Andretti Andretti Autosport Dallara/Honda 225.184 39.9674s 63
5 J.R. Hildebrand CFH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 224.760 40.0428s 61
6 Ed Carpenter CFH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 224.738 40.0466s 79
7 Carlos Munoz Andretti Autosport Dallara/Honda 224.693 40.0546s 36
8 Justin Wilson Andretti Autosport Dallara/Honda 224.242 40.1353s 44
9 Takuma Sato AJ Foyt Enterprises Dallara/Honda 224.239 40.1357s 45
10 Josef Newgarden CFH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 224.193 40.1440s 83
11 James Hinchcliffe Schmidt Peterson Motorsports Dallara/Honda 224.174 40.1473s 36
12 Gabby Chaves Bryan Herta Autosport Dallara/Honda 224.173 40.1475s 8
13 Simona de Silvestro Andretti Autosport Dallara/Honda 223.684 40.2353s 42
14 Townsend Bell Dreyer and Reinbold Dallara/Chevrolet 223.637 40.2437s 39
15 Graham Rahal Rahal Letterman Lanigan Dallara/Honda 223.582 40.2536s 77
16 James Jakes Schmidt Peterson Motorsports Dallara/Honda 223.499 40.2686s 36
17 Sebastien Bourdais KVSH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 223.419 40.2831s 34
18 Oriol Servia Rahal Letterman Lanigan Dallara/Honda 223.301 40.3043s 58
19 Simon Pagenaud Team Penske Dallara/Chevrolet 222.885 40.3795s 31
20 Charlie Kimball Chip Ganassi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 222.100 40.5223s 19
21 Ryan Hunter-Reay Andretti Autosport Dallara/Honda 222.034 40.5343s 68
22 Conor Daly Schmidt Peterson Motorsports Dallara/Honda 221.742 40.5878s 28
23 Sebastian Saavedra Chip Ganassi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 220.438 40.8278s 16
24 Stefano Coletti KV Racing Technology Dallara/Chevrolet 219.748 40.9560s 37
25 Pippa Mann Dale Coyne Racing Dallara/Honda 219.267 41.0458s 6
26 Bryan Clauson KVSH Racing Dallara/Chevrolet 219.151 41.0676s 31
27 Carlos Huertas Dale Coyne Racing Dallara/Honda 216.993 41.4759s 18
28 Juan Pablo Montoya Team Penske Dallara/Chevrolet 150.312 59.8754s 3
29 Helio Castroneves Team Penske Dallara/Chevrolet 141.897 1m03.4265s 1
30 Will Power Team Penske Dallara/Chevrolet 137.763 1m05.3294s 1
